First set of Sonoma Valley community members complete Community Emergency Response Team training

The first Spanish-speaking group of Sonoma Valley community members completed Community Emergency Response Team training on March 29. This training, taught entirely in Spanish, represents the Sonoma County Department of Emergency Management’s commitment to disaster preparedness. It is the second of three Spanish CERT classes offered by the department, the first being completed by community members from Santa Rosa. Read full story

Sonoma County partners with the National Weather Service Bay Area for a weather radio emergency alert test

The County of Sonoma and the National Weather Service Bay Area (NWS) are conducting an emergency alert test of National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A) weather radios on Tuesday, April 8, at 11:30 a.m. The exercise will last approximately one hour and will be a countywide test of the NOAA Weather Radio alert system. After the test, participants will be encouraged to provide feedback on whether the test message was received by their radio. Read full story

Board of Supervisors moves forward with intent to purchase office buildings

The Sonoma County Board of Supervisors today signaled its intent to purchase two modern office buildings near the Charles M. Schulz-Sonoma County Airport, the next step in a larger plan for re-envisioning the County Government Center. Read full story

Sonoma County Housing Authority announces approval of annual and five-year plans for Housing Choice Voucher Program

The Board of Supervisors today, acting as the Sonoma County Housing Authority Commission, approved the Public Housing Authority’s annual and five-year plans for the administration of the Housing Choice Voucher Program under contract with the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development. This pivotal program is the largest initiative run by the Community Development Commission and is essential in providing housing stability for low-income households throughout Sonoma County.
